You guys (and gals) may want to hold off on your orders from that site (bestpricecameras.com) and read this Best Price Cameras (enterprisephoto.com, infinitiphoto.com, jandkcameras.com) Customer Ratings, Reviews and Prices at ResellerRatings


Seems as these cameras DO NOT come with a FACTORY warranty nor do they come with anything that you would typically get when purchasing one elsewhere. It also seems that these are not camera originally made for the US market. I would not buy IMO.

Im not sure what they would try to sell you for a lens...

but for the camera it seems they sell you accessories that typically come with the camera for exuberant prices and if you do not go for it they wont ship your products. Even if there were nothing to upsell, I really wouldnt trust them with my billing info. From everything Ive read they seem pretty shady. Id much rather deal with the likes of B&H and Adorama and at least know you are dealing with an honest reputable company.
